Three decanters and three stoppers, comprising: one of mallet shape inscribed WHITE WINE within a cartouche and pendant and scrolling flowers and foliage; another etched with Masonic devices including a set-square and dividers between a a trowel and spade beneath an all-seeing eye, the Sun and Moon supported on pillars to each side, on a plain fluted ground; and an oviform decanter cut with oval lenses within stylised garlands, engraved G.H. monogram, all circa 1800 or early 19th Century (6)
